// Convenience macros for checking null-ness of pointers.
//
// Purportedly, gtest should support pointer comparison when the first argument
// is a pointer (e.g. NULL). It is therefore appropriate to use
// {ASSERT,EXPECT}_{EQ,NE} for our purposes. However, gtest fails to realize
// that NULL is a pointer when used with the _NE variants, unless we explicitly
// cast it to a pointer type, and so we inject this casting.
//
// Note that checking nullness of the content of a scoped_ptr requires getting
// the inner pointer value via get().
#define UMTEST_ASSERT_NULL(p) ASSERT_EQ(NULL, p)
#define UMTEST_ASSERT_NOT_NULL(p) ASSERT_NE(reinterpret_cast<void*>(NULL), p)
#define UMTEST_EXPECT_NULL(p) EXPECT_EQ(NULL, p)
#define UMTEST_EXPECT_NOT_NULL(p) EXPECT_NE(reinterpret_cast<void*>(NULL), p)
namespace chromeos_update_manager {
// A help class with common functionality for use in Update Manager testing.
class UmTestUtils {
public:
// A default timeout to use when making various queries.
static const base::TimeDelta DefaultTimeout() {
return base::TimeDelta::FromSeconds(kDefaultTimeoutInSeconds);
}
// Calls GetValue on |variable| and expects its result to be |expected|.
template<typename T>
static void ExpectVariableHasValue(const T& expected, Variable<T>* variable) {
UMTEST_ASSERT_NOT_NULL(variable);
scoped_ptr<const T> value(variable->GetValue(DefaultTimeout(), nullptr));
UMTEST_ASSERT_NOT_NULL(value.get()) << "Variable: " << variable->GetName();
EXPECT_EQ(expected, *value) << "Variable: " << variable->GetName();
}
// Calls GetValue on |variable| and expects its result to be null.
template<typename T>
static void ExpectVariableNotSet(Variable<T>* variable) {
UMTEST_ASSERT_NOT_NULL(variable);
scoped_ptr<const T> value(variable->GetValue(DefaultTimeout(), nullptr));
UMTEST_EXPECT_NULL(value.get()) << "Variable: " << variable->GetName();
}
private:
static const unsigned kDefaultTimeoutInSeconds;
};
// PrintTo() functions are used by gtest to print these values. They need to be
// defined on the same namespace where the type was defined.
void PrintTo(const EvalStatus& status, ::std::ostream* os);
} // namespace chromeos_update_manager
